Ilrun - inflammation and lipid regulator with UBA-like and NBR1-like domains Gene
Also Known as RGD1310148
Species: Rattus norvegicus
Summary
Predicted to enable ubiquitin binding activity. Predicted to be involved in several processes, including negative regulation of cytokine production; negative regulation of defense response to virus; and negative regulation of protein localization to nucleus. Predicted to be located in centrosome; cytosol; and nuclear speck. Predicted to be active in phagophore assembly site. Orthologous to human ILRUN (inflammation and lipid regulator with UBA-like and NBR1-like domains).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
